Engineers have actually come up with a rating system to measure the effectiveness of attic insulation in Seagoville, TX. The R-value of an insulation is the material's resistance to conductive heat flow. The higher the R-value, the more effective the Seagoville attic insulation is. What are the Different Types of Attic Insulation in Seagoville, TX?

Traditionally, the most common form of insulation is fiberglass rolled batts. This kind of attic insulation in Seagoville, TX is a streamlined design which only needs to be rolled out in between the spaces in the attic and affix them. Sometimes another layer can be added. For larger spaces that are hard to reach blown-in attic insulation for Seagoville, TX is ideal. This requires the use of heavy equipment, but will fill any difficult space. Finally for the tiny spaces, foam insulation is best for small jobs, like a crack in the foundation or a drafty window. Whichever type of Seagoville attic insulation you choose depends on the space that you're trying to insulate.
